Laurus Labs Limited — PPTs, 25-07-2025: Investor Presentation
**Financial Highlights:**
Laurus Labs reported strong Q1 FY26 financial results with ₹1,570 Cr revenue, up 31% year-on-year. EBITDA surged 127% to ₹389 Cr, expanding margins by 10.5 percentage points to 24.8%. Gross margins held strong at 59.4%. The company noted continued recovery in asset turnover levels.
**Strategic Initiatives & Growth Drivers:**
Robust CDMO momentum and growth in generics are key drivers. Strategic investments continue with Q1 CAPEX at ₹265 Cr (17% of sales), including groundbreaking for new Gene/ADC and Microbial fermentation facilities. The focus is on enhancing manufacturing networks and specialized modalities.
**Business Developments:**
CDMO – Small Molecules saw over 130% growth. The KRKA joint venture's finished formulation facility broke ground, with an initial investment of over ₹500 Cr planned. Cell therapy showed continued demand for NexCAR19, with a second GMP facility opening soon, and a new Gene/ADC manufacturing facility is underway.
**Market Position & Competitive Advantage:**
Laurus Labs leverages an integrated ‘D&M’ platform and unique capabilities, supported by over 110 active pipeline projects. Strong R&D platforms, including biocatalysis and flow chemistry, underpin its offerings. The company maintains high global quality standards with numerous regulatory certifications.
